Bourbon County Commissioners received a rundown of the county’s finances for the past year during an audit report May 20.

Emily Franks with Jarred, Gilmore, Phillips PA said the firm prepared the audit that shows the county’s receipts, expenditures and unencumbered cash balances as of Dec. 31. Franks said the county did not incur any state or federal violations, but there were a couple of “material weaknesses” identified as areas of improvement.
